Alim McNeill on the Brink of Return to Lions’ Defense

Alim McNeill is making significant strides toward returning to the Detroit Lions’ lineup after a lengthy recovery from a torn ACL. Since suffering the injury last December, McNeill has been diligently working his way back to full health. General manager Brad Holmes noted in August that the defensive tackle was ahead of his rehabilitation schedule, fueling optimism among Lions fans.

Positive Update from the Coaching Staff

On Monday, head coach Dan Campbell shared an encouraging update regarding McNeill’s status. He indicated that the Lions are poised to open the 21-day practice window for their standout defender this week.

“We’re close on Mac,” Campbell stated during his press conference. “There’s a good chance we may start Mac’s clock this week. That’s good. We’re just — we want to make sure we check all those boxes before we say that’s what we’re going to do for sure. But it’s trending the right way. Mac’s — he’s about ready to go, and I think he’s tired of training.”

McNeill has been on the physically unable to perform (PUP) list since the offseason, and with his mandatory four-week stay concluding, he is now eligible for a return. However, the Lions are expected to be cautious. They will likely designate him for return first, giving them 21 days to activate him. It’s probable that Detroit will utilize most, if not all, of that window, which could delay his return until Week 7.

Impact on the Lions’ Defense

When McNeill does return, his presence will be a significant asset to a Lions defense that is already ranked among the top 10 units in the league against the run. Additionally, he will enhance the team’s pass-rush capabilities, having recorded 8.5 sacks in just 27 games over the past two seasons. His return could make a noticeable difference as the Lions aim to solidify their defensive front.
